Transaction 4c59e93e33a8ffcef838393196762132d81efe8a7efedf3a799757b427ce2fc7

1 Input
2 Outputs
  • 4c59e93e33a8ffcef838393196762132d81efe8a7efedf3a799757b427ce2fc7:0
  • value  1043000
    address  3AJq3b4DpJ1zfQgQSR3pam1UkqEt5a1Psf
  • 4c59e93e33a8ffcef838393196762132d81efe8a7efedf3a799757b427ce2fc7:1
  • value  5867531
    address  1Kt3jR121mZvY6D9y5Qvjqzj5mYEuWXXxX